Transaction 25f86edaad218752fa74a94469157012d20d2151443c7bf1610a9c64df0e6625

1 Input
2 Outputs
  • 25f86edaad218752fa74a94469157012d20d2151443c7bf1610a9c64df0e6625:0
  • value  12968
    address  1KwLKT8fSwwKBFYEhPkCSGFYtrgGrjt76A
  • 25f86edaad218752fa74a94469157012d20d2151443c7bf1610a9c64df0e6625:1
  • value  10243686
    address  37FTvtM89mF8bML8fNDmz2PkLvKuevxrfk